I have a 2021 MY made in 4/2021, I'm smack dab in the middle of when the PWS was added (~9/2020) and when the manual says the following feature is unavailable (11/2021).

Supposedly there is a way to pause the PWS (temporarily) under Controls -> Safety -> Pedestrian Warning -> Pause.

I do not see it in my car though. Not sure if this matters, but I subscribed to FSD for a month and am on 2023.26.10 (FSD 11.4.4).
Has anyone with a Tesla (preferably 3/Y) made between 9/1/2020 and 11/1/2021 seen this magical feature?
Is the FSD thing affecting this option?

I have a 2021 M3 built prior to Nov 2021 and have no PWS controls. If the car ever did have a pause control, it was removed in a software update long ago.

I also have a 2023 MY with no pause control. Curiously, neither car has ever activated PWS when in Drive. It is only active in reverse.
 
We have a 2022 model Y and a 2023 model 3. I believe both of them make a specific sound during low-speed reverse, and a DIFFERENT and softer sound during low-speed forward. I did not notice either of them until I had owned the car for several weeks, and a friend whom I was picking up at his home complimented me on the nice sound it made in reverse.

Still later I realized on going out to the garage to greet my wife driving in with the Y that there was a specific sound which shut down when she had arrived (I think it quits when she gets into Park, but not sure on that).
